Pick the best description of energy efficiency?

A efficiency is equal to the ratio of energy you put into the energy you get out
B efficiency is equal to the ratio of energy you get out to the energy you put in
C efficiency is equal to the sum of the energy you put into the energy you get out

The answer is B. Efficiency is equal to the ratio of energy you get out (output) to the energy you put in (input). Say for a basic example you got a converted output of 40W from 50W input, you'll have an efficiency of 80 percent only.
